The Minnesota State High School League has called a special meeting at 8 a.m. Wednesday to address weather concerns.
With schools across the state facing a second week of postponed baseball and softball games because of cold and snow-covered fields, the league's board members are expected to vote on a temporary rule change dealing with game lengths. Likely outcomes include more doubleheaders and games with fewer innings.
While spring sports face weather-related challenges every year, the league hasn't had to consider these types of measures since 2013.
